为了账号安全,请及时绑定邮箱和手机立即绑定

method=post/get,有何区别?

method=post/get,有何区别?

宁馨儿2 2017-01-19 11:54:36
查看完整描述

4 回答

?
北京小前端

TA贡献7条经验 获得超6个赞

一般来说除了需要传用户个人的信息用post,其余几乎都用get。

查看完整回答
1 反对 回复 2017-01-25
?
stella_15

TA贡献18条经验 获得超12个赞

如果你了解一点Restful,就会知道在restful里他们的影响贯彻到了请求的各个方面,包括接口设计。如果一个更新请求用了get,leader会找你,改!

正在被虐的人答~

查看完整回答
反对 回复 2017-01-24
?
乐滔滔

TA贡献1条经验 获得超0个赞

get和post请求,在http协议中信息存放的位置不同,get将信息存放在http协议header中,有长度的限制,而且浏览器会缓存get请求的地址,如果地址不变,第二次请求不会真的发送到服务器。post请求是将信息存放到http协议的body中,没有长度限制,浏览器每次都会执行post请求,不会缓存,post请求如果在服务器端执行新增数据时应该注意重复提交的问题,避免数据重复。
查看完整回答
反对 回复 2017-01-20
?
你一出场别人显得不过如此

TA贡献5条经验 获得超4个赞

向服务器发送请求的方式,get参数会显示在地址栏,post则不会

查看完整回答
反对 回复 2017-01-19
?
_潇潇暮雨

TA贡献646条经验 获得超225个赞

主要是语义上的区别。GET获取数据,POST提交数据。

查看完整回答
反对 回复 2017-01-19
  • 4 回答
  • 0 关注
  • 2301 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信